Definitions:

Normal Curve

A bell-shaped curve representing a distribution of values, traits, or scores where most occurrences take place in the middle of the range.

Standard Deviations

A measure of the dispersion or variability within a set of numerical data, indicating how much each value differs from the mean of the dataset.
